The Farelab ticket-pricing experiment service rejected last night's config push with a signature mismatch, so the new fare variants never went live and all venues fell back to baseline pricing. Root cause: the config was signed with the retired staging key after last week's rotation. No customer-facing pricing errors occurred. Support should tell experimenters to re-sign configs with the current key and resubmit; pushes verified against it deploy normally. The active verification key is below.

release key, bahof-hafog: bky3_ztf

**Mgmt Meeting Minutes — Retiring the Brightline Range**

Quick recap for sales leads at Fenholt Supplies: we agreed to retire the Brightline fixture range by year-end. Remaining stock moves to clearance pricing next month, and accounts on standing orders get migrated to the Lumetta range. Trade-in incentives were approved in principle. The confidential note on next steps sits just below.

board note of bajof-bajeg: The pricing group signed off on a budget of $13.4 million for Project Sildor. The renewal with Lamixek Holdings closes at $48.9 million a year, 49 percent above the last contract.

Migration step 4: the Larkspur service now builds under the Quillstone hermetic toolchain. All system headers come from the pinned sysroot; anything reaching for /usr/include will fail loudly, which is intended. Reviewers should confirm the lockfile diff only touches the three vendored tarballs and that no genrule shells out to curl. The sandbox run completed twice with identical output hashes. The canonical build token is recorded below for verification.

pipeline stamp: htk9_ce63042d9

## Deployment

Ledgerleaf performs all currency conversion in fixed-point minor units to avoid float rounding drift. Plugin authors must not re-round converted amounts; the core applies banker's rounding once, at display time. Deploy the conversion service before any plugins that read rates, or cached rates may be stale. At startup the service reads the following configuration values.

deployment values, yadug-bawif:
[framir]
team = pelox
access_code = ac_a38ab2
owner = tamion.julael
host = framir.tolvaqlabs.test
port = 11211
peer = tammir.zemvargrid.local
salt = 2215ef03
pin = 1541